The cheapest way to get from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ct is to drive which costs £11 - £17 and takes 1h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ct is to drive which takes 1h 1m and costs £11 - £17.
No, there is no direct train from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ct. However, there are services departing from Harrogate and arriving at Ribblehead via Leeds.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 5m.
The distance between Harrogate and Ribblehead Viaduct is 50 miles. The road distance is 47.9 miles.
The best way to get from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ct without a car is to line 59 bus and train which takes 2h 53m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 53m to get from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ct, including transfers.
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ct train services, operated by Northern Trains Limited, depart from Harrogate station.
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ct train services, operated by Northern Trains Limited, arrive at Leeds station.
Yes, the driving distance between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ct is 48 miles. It takes approximately 1h 1m to drive from Harrogate to Ribblehead Viaduct.
